Thursday's FIA press conference – part two

  Max Verstappen, Sergio Perez, Stoffel Vandoorne and Kevin Magnussen are quizzed by the press ahead of the Hungarian Grand Prix weekend. PART TWO: DRIVERS – Max VERSTAPPEN (Red Bull), Sergio PÉREZ (Force India), Stoffel VANDOORNE (McLaren), Kevin MAGNUSSEN (Haas) Q: Session one we had a lot of talk about the implementation of the Halo cockpit head protection in 2018. I’d just like to get each of your thoughts on that. Perhaps we could start with Max. Max VERSTAPPEN: OK, yeah, I don’t like it but of course at the end of the day you have to respect the decision of the FIA.
